← Все проекты
Проект / Python

yazinsai/yt-to-site: yt-to-site — превратите YouTube-канал в многоязычный контент-сайт

Одной командой превратите любой YouTube-канал в статический многоязычный сайт с SEO, переводами и умными ссылками — без базы данных.

Укажите handle канала и список языков. Инструмент пошагово синхронизирует видео, транскрибирует их через ClipScript, переводит содержимое на несколько языков, связывает похожие видео семантическими ссылками и создаёт SEO-описания. На выходе — статический...

★ 12 Python Форки 2 Issue 0 Оценка 8/10 Карточка проверена

Для кого это

Подходит разработчикам, которые хотят быстро развернуть сайт на основе YouTube-контента, а также владельцам каналов, готовым настроить пару конфигов и API-ключей.

Проблема / задача

Создание сайта на основе YouTube-канала вручную — это долго: нужно скачивать видео, транскрибировать, переводить, проставлять ссылки и заботиться об SEO. yt-to-site автоматизирует весь процесс от синхронизации метаданных до генерации статического сайта.

Как это работает

Укажите handle канала и список языков. Инструмент пошагово синхронизирует видео, транскрибирует их через ClipScript, переводит содержимое на несколько языков, связывает похожие видео семантическими ссылками и создаёт SEO-описания. На выходе — статический Next.js-сайт, который читает JSONL-файлы и не требует базы данных. Конвейер возобновляем: при ошибке он продолжит с места остановки.

Что видно по README

yt-to-site — это CLI-утилита на Python, которая автоматически строит многоязычный сайт по YouTube-каналу. В основе лежит конвейер: синхронизация → транскрибация → суммаризация → перевод → интерлинковка → SEO. Для транскрибации используется сервис ClipScript, для перевода и суммаризации — OpenRouter, для семантических связей — Cohere. Все данные хранятся в JSONL-файлах, фронтенд — Next.js. Проект под лицензией MIT,...

Ключевые возможности

Полный конвейер от YouTube до статического сайта: синхронизация, транскрибация, суммаризация, перевод на множество языковАвтоматическая генерация SEO-метаданных для каждой локалиУмная интерлинковка: семантические ссылки между похожими видеоВозобновляемый конвейер — при прерывании прогресс сохраняетсяНе требует базы данных: все данные в JSONL, фронтенд на Next.jsОпциональная поддержка валидации коранических стихов

Технологии

PythonNext.jsClipScriptYouTube Data APIOpenRouterCohere

Интересный факт

В проекте есть опциональный модуль для валидации и исправления коранических стихов — он пригодится создателям исламского контента.

С чего начать

  • Установите: pip install -e .
  • Скопируйте шаблоны конфигов: cp config.example.yaml config.yaml и .env.example .env, затем укажите handle канала и API-ключи
  • Запустите инициализацию: yts init config.yaml, а затем полный конвейер: yts run config.yaml

Оценка GitRadar

Удобство
8/10
Свежесть
8/10
Перспектива
8/10
Монетизация
6/10
Общая оценка
8/10

Вердикт GitRadar

Стоит попробовать, если вам нужно быстро и без заморочек получить сайт на основе YouTube-канала с мультиязычностью и SEO. Однако потребуется настроить четыре API-ключа (YouTube, ClipScript, OpenRouter, Cohere) и немного разобраться с конфигурацией.

Наблюдения по обновлениям

Проект свежий (0.1.0), активных issues нет, но звёзд и форков пока мало — сообщество только формируется.

Что мы проверили

Карточка собрана по данным GitHub, README и структуре репозитория. Это не официальная документация проекта.

Исходный репозиторий
https://github.com/yazinsai/yt-to-site
Лицензия
MIT
Создан на GitHub
14 апреля 2026 г.
Последнее обновление репо
14 апреля 2026 г.
Последняя проверка GitRadar
14 апреля 2026 г.
Изученные файлы
README.md, pyproject.toml, yt_to_site/cli.py, web/package.json, web/app/layout.tsx, web/lib/types.ts

FAQ

Что это такое?

yt-to-site — утилита, которая по одному YouTube-каналу создаёт готовый многоязычный сайт с переводами, SEO и связями между видео.

Для кого подходит?

Для разработчиков, которые хотят автоматизировать создание контентного сайта YouTube, и для владельцев каналов, готовых разобраться с настройками.

Источники

  • GitHub исходный код и активность
  • README описание, ссылки, стартовые материалы

Нужна помощь с yazinsai/yt-to-site?

Если проект подходит под ваш сценарий, можем помочь с установкой, интеграцией, доработкой или аккуратным форком под вашу инфраструктуру.